Full Job Description

đź“‹ Description

  • • Own the end-to-end customer relationship as the primary point of contact, building trust across all organizational levels and candidly communicating tradeoffs on AI-powered solutions.
  • • Translate ambiguous business goals — such as automating medical coding, improving customer service, or building data connectors from API docs — into crisp problem statements, user journeys, and measurable success metrics in collaboration with clients.
  • • Define product requirements, PRDs, and evaluation criteria for AI systems, turning messy, unstructured needs into clear technical specifications for engineering teams.
  • • Drive execution across multiple AI product initiatives simultaneously, managing planning cycles, daily check-ins, risk tracking, and cross-functional coordination between customers, engineers, designers, and internal Fractional teams.
  • • Act as a forward-deployed operator by jumping into gaps — writing SQL queries, drafting support playbooks, or leading last-minute executive demos — to ensure projects stay on track and deliver real business impact.
  • • Engage in early-stage, vague client conversations to help founders and sales teams uncover real pain points, sketch solution approaches in real time, and identify expansion opportunities beyond initial scope.
  • • Lead adoption and change management efforts by working directly with client teams on rollout, training, and enablement to ensure AI systems are actively used and integrated into workflows.
  • • Bring clarity and judgment during ambiguity, reframing problems, holding the line on quality, and articulating clear plans when requirements shift or stakeholders are misaligned.
  • • Ship two to three AI-powered products per year in a fast-paced environment, with high autonomy but tight timelines, learning from dozens of other projects and contributing to Fractional’s evolving product playbooks.
  • • Work at the frontier of LLMs and AI tooling, experimenting with cutting-edge models and workflows, and overusing AI in your own processes to drive efficiency and innovation.
  • • Maintain a bias for action and ownership, rolling up your sleeves to solve problems directly rather than delegating, whether that means debugging a data pipeline or drafting a client-facing presentation.
  • • Thrive in high-intensity, ambiguous environments where projects are often "we haven’t done this before," requiring rapid learning, juggling multiple clients, and making decisions with incomplete information.
  • • Bring structured problem-solving skills to transform whiteboard discussions with executives into clear, actionable engineering documents without losing strategic context.
  • • Contribute to company culture by embodying values of overdelivering, overusing AI, and over-engineering the team experience — prioritizing what makes Fractional a better place for its people.

🎯 Requirements

  • • 4–8 years of experience in product management, consulting, or implementations with customer-facing, high-stakes projects involving ambiguous goals and misaligned stakeholders.
  • • Proven track record of building and shipping products with engineers and designers across multiple cycles, including running execution rhythms like stand-ups, planning, and retros without process theater.
  • • Strong structured problem-solving and communication skills: ability to turn chaos into clear plans, from executive-level whiteboarding to detailed engineering documentation.
  • • Bias for action and ownership: willingness to do whatever it takes — from writing SQL to leading demos — to unblock progress and deliver results.
  • • Comfort with ambiguity and intensity: ability to manage multiple clients, prioritize under uncertainty, and thrive in fast-paced, "first-of-its-kind" AI projects.
  • • Curiosity about AI and willingness to learn quickly; no deep AI expertise required on day one, but must actively experiment with AI tools in your own workflow.
